augmentation. Job Summary: This individual will work closely with
the OR team including the Surgeons, Anesthesiologist, CRNA, OR
Circulator and Surgical Technologist. The individual will be
engaged and fully understand the Mission, Values, and Strategy.
This position requires the individual to be self-motivated and able
to work independently.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
Performs technical skills May help set up operating room, prepare
and transport patients for surgery, adjust lights and equipment,
pass instruments and other supplies to surgeons and surgeon's
assistants, hold retractors, cut sutures, and help count sponges,
needles, supplies, and instruments Adjusts actions in relation to
others actions. Provides assistance to surgeons, anesthesia
personnel, registered nurses, and other professionals in the
operating room Performs similar duties in other areas of the
Practice as assigned. Has direct knowledge of the surgical field,
maintaining sterility, as well as processing on instruments and
sterilization. Requirements Graduate of a formal training program.
Two years direct experience scrubbing General Surgery Cases At
least one year experience processing instruments Graduate of a
recognized and accredited Surgical Technologist Program preferred.
Current Surgical Technologist certification CPR Certificate Ability
to work independently Attention to Detail and following Policies
set forth by the Department. Critical Thinking Skills along with
